reverup, is that a ktm keihin your running?

I've got the stock 36mm on my 11 250, I'm not sure how different the ktm carb is, I'm still not real happy, it's not quite as crisp as my ktm 200 is, I'm going to try the YZ needle you run next

That is the stock 36mm. My first 36mm as all my other Gas Gas 300's had the 38mm. From what I have been told it is the same as the KTM's.

The YZ needle cleaned it up nicely and is still currently in the carb. Try it I think you will approve.

I have one on order, I'm using a CCK @3 right now, with a 40 pilot and 180 main, riding in mostly sand @ 200'

I think mine came with a #7 slide, not really sure

I just went from a CCK #4 to the EJ #3 middle, the power is crisp but it's missing some roll on power, makes it harder for me to wheelie in 2nd & 3rd, it may be wheel spinning too easy, it's hard for me to tell, I did not get to ride too long, son broke down
